# Client for the Farepoint pricing experiment service. Support: this only
# affects ticket prices shown in the Orlin web checkout, variants A–C.
# Refunds always use the price the customer actually paid, so no manual
# adjustments needed. The client talks to the internal experiment API and
# authenticates with the key that follows.

gateway credential: vxb4-QTMv

Hi Petra — while I'm out, the prototype workshop on Level 3 is your responsibility. It houses the Oakliff test rigs and 3D printers, so only names on the approved list may enter; the list is pinned inside the door. Visitors must be escorted at all times and sign the workshop log. Please check the printers are powered down at closing. The keypad by the door takes the code below.

badge for hawip-taweg: bdg-QFZSW-38965

## Deployment

Sproutclock runs as a small scheduled worker plus an HTTP API. The worker wakes every few minutes, evaluates soil-moisture readings against each plant's profile, and enqueues watering jobs; the API only serves schedule reads and overrides. Both processes share one config file loaded at startup — there is no hot reload, so changes require a restart. Reviewers should check that new settings are validated in the loader before use. The defaults shipped with the current release are listed below.

config for kajog-tadug:
[casax]
port = 11211
region = west-3
host = casax.nelvroworks.internal
timeout_ms = 5000
retries = 7

- [ ] Before the Quillhaven signing ceremony proceeds, run the leaked-file-descriptor hunt on the offline signer. As a new contractor, please be thorough: enumerate every open descriptor on the sealed host, confirm nothing points at the ceremony scratch volume, and log each finding in the Larkspur register. If any descriptor traces back to the retired Fenwick exporter, halt and page the ceremony lead. Once the host shows a clean descriptor table, unlock the escrow envelope using the phrase below.

unlock words, yajof-tagef: aldiel-kasath-briax-fraeth-pelius-olieth-pelix-wenius-wenael-norael